All the waveforms from V4 and V5 look like they have a bunch of intermittent spikes where sync should be?? Not sure what I'm looking at. What was the video signal, and was it coming through the antenna?
Yes, the signal was RF coming thru the antenna terminals. I think the resolution isn't the greatest on the little Tek 224, maybe why it appears that way? Might need to go back over with my big Tek.

Voltage checks on V4 ok except pins 8 and 9 which were about 70 and 50 v too high, respectively.

Voltage checks on AGC V6 appear ok, except maybe pin 7 which was about 10v high. I need to mull over this data to figure out what it means, but I think there's a connection between the AGC (as someone else may have alluded to earlier) and the 1st video stage...

What's totally puzzling is that the 100v and 390v rails going to V4 test ok
